The automotive Radio Detection and Ranging (radar) global market is estimated to reach almost $8B USD in 2021, playing an important role in enabling driverless cars. NXP is leading the way with radar solution development and has developed a dedicated reference design for adaptive cruise control (ACC) and automatic emergency braking (AEB) applications. The RDK-S32R274 Radar reference design offers a complete automotive radar solution including a high-performance MCU, a 77 GHz radar transceiver, and automotive-qualified radar software.
This training provides an in-depth understanding of the global radar market and explains how the RDK-S32R274 can impact your product development cycle. We will also explore the out-of-the-box experience and the development environment, together with some compelling "real world" examples.
